H1354 Hebrew

גַב

gab (gab)
the back (as rounded); by analogy, the top or rim, a boss, a vault, arch of eye, bulwarks, etc.

KJV Translations of H1354

back, body, boss, eminent (higher) place, (eye) brows, nave, ring.

Word Origin & Derivation

from an unused root meaning to hollow or curve; (compare H1460 (גֵּו) and H1479 (גּוּף))
